Default "Wheel Hop" on 04 Rancher AT

My 7 month old rancher AT has been nothing but steller thus far, but I have a question about what feels like a "wheel hop" from the left front end as I go down a paved street. Any idea if this is an alignment issue? Any recommendations as to whether I need to take it in for service, or is this common.
